Energy Transition and Resource Governance: A Mining Agenda for Latin America and the Caribbean

The global energy transition is driving unprecedented demand for critical minerals, positioning Latin America and the Caribbean as a key region for the supply of essential inputs for clean technologies. This situation represents a historic opportunity to transform the region's geological potential into sustainable development, economic diversification, and social well-being. However, achieving this goal requires strengthening governance frameworks, ensuring equitable benefit distribution, and moving toward more responsible and traceable mining.
This session will analyze how the region can competitively integrate into global value chains, confront geopolitical pressure, and build a mining agenda aligned with the Sustainable Development Goals through industrial policies, public-private partnerships, and transparency and inclusion mechanisms.
